- TRACEX; Epic TraceXA TRACEX file can refer to one of two distinct file formats: a car diagnostic log file, primarily used by TRACEX software for storing vehicle diagnostic data, or an Epic trace file, a zipped archive used by Epic TraceX within Epic Hyperspace to capture performance data. The former is more common, representing approximately 79% of all *.TRACEX files, while the latter accounts for about 20%. It's crucial to differentiate between these two types as they serve entirely different purposes and are associated with distinct software applications. The car diagnostic files are essential for troubleshooting vehicle issues, while the Epic trace files are used for optimizing the performance of electronic health record systems. The TRACEX file extension is rarely used and mainly uses a defined TRACEX format. But the following two file formats are common:
- 85% of all TRACEX files start with the bytes 00 00 00 00 crucial for this file format. The content consists of illegible binary data, which can only be read and interpreted by the associated programs. TRACEX files can be up to 12 KB in size, but are often around 290 bytes - 5 KB. The file type was created recently. These files are often associated with volvo, benz, reset, landrover, citroen, jaguar, ford and opel.
- 15% of all TRACEX files internally use the ZIP format, i.e. a TRACEX file contains several compressed files. Such a ZIP file contains 10 to 12 files with names like [Content_Types].xml, config.xml, summary.xml, version.xml, \_rels\.rels, \server\_rels\request.raw.rels, \server\_rels\trace.xml.rels, \server\metadata.xml, \server\request.raw, \server\session.xml and \server\trace.xml. A little tip: If you rename the file extension to .zip and then double-click, you will see the included files and images. TRACEX files can be up to 42 KB in size, but are often around 4 KB - 19 KB.
